No Incidents During Contact-Line Monitoring Between Azeri and NKR Armed Forces

PanARMENIAN.Net - On January 10, according to the earlier agreement with the authorities of NKR, the OSCE mission carried out a planned monitoring of contact-line between the Nagorno Karabakh and Azeri armed forces in Aghdam direction, near Yusufjanlli settlement. The PanARMENIAN.Net journalist was told in the NKR MFA that from the positions of Karabakh army the monitoring was being carried out by OSCE Chairman-in-Office personal representative Peter Kee (Great Britain), Gunter Volk (Germany) and Miroslav Vimetal (Czech Republic). The monitoring was carried out according to the timetable. No records of breaking the cease-fire. From Karabakh side representatives of Defense and Foreign ministries were accompanying the OSCE mission.
